Many states, such as California, Florida, and Massachusetts, are "two-party consent" states, meaning all parties being recorded must consent to audio capture. Under Michigan law, for instance, installing a device to eavesdrop or record in a private place without the consent of the person entitled to privacy there is explicitly prohibited. Conversely, Maryland law carves out an exception, making it lawful for a person to use a security camera on their own property to intercept oral communications. This legal nuance means a simple doorbell camera could theoretically violate state wiretapping laws if its audio recording capabilities are enabled without the knowledge of neighbors.

Security cameras rarely operate in isolation. They connect to broader smart home ecosystems, including voice assistants, smart displays, and third-party automation apps. Each connection creates a new link in the security chain. A vulnerability in a smart lighting app, for example, could potentially grant an intruder access to the connected security camera network.
